Battery discharged

So I got this warning today. I have seen the increased battery discharge warning before, but this is the first time I got the full out "Battery Discharged" warning.

Does this mean the battery will fail soon even after driving? I.e take a picture and try to have it replaced under warranty (the car is 1.5y old). It doesn't get driven a lot especially in the last month.

Driving your car, especially a longer drive without a lot of stop and go will charge your battery pretty effectively. However, you may not be able to do this currently (pun intended).

Do you have a garage and park your car in your garage? If so, do you lock it every time you park the car? If you don't lock your car it can take ~10 minutes before everything gets powered down. Locking your car powers down everything immediately and helps prevent battery drain.

If you have a garage the best solution if you're not driving it during the pandemic shut-down is to get a CTEK Lithium Ion battery charger and keep it plugged in. Lots of posts about this charger, do a search for more info.

I have the same issue as I live very centrally and close to all my stops in general and especially during this time. i get that warning upon getting in the car most times and if the ride is too short like just to grab a bottle or some take out etc then it will go off after parking it back in the garage. If I go for a longer drive and make a few stops and don't shut it off in between the warning goes away. this is on a brand new battery as well as the previous one was replaced by BMW right before I bought the car. they told me some story about the battery being $2k to replace. seems crazy but with BMW OEM who knows...
